
To understand the role of Selenium in supporting test automation within Agile software development environments.
To analyze the benefits and challenges of implementing Selenium-based automation in mid to large-scale organizations.
To evaluate how Selenium aligns with Agile principles such as continuous integration, iterative development, and frequent releases.
To assess the impact of test automation on software quality, testing speed, and team collaboration.
To recommend best practices for scaling Selenium test automation effectively in Agile enterprise settings.
Conduct a literature review on Selenium WebDriver, Agile testing practices, and test automation frameworks.
Study the integration of Selenium with tools like Jenkins, Git, TestNG, Cucumber, and JIRA for CI/CD and Agile workflows.
Identify automation use cases such as regression testing, cross-browser testing, and smoke testing in Agile sprints.
Analyze real-world case studies of mid to large-scale organizations adopting Selenium automation in Agile setups.
Evaluate key metrics like test execution time, defect detection rate, test coverage, and release velocity.
Identify common challenges such as test flakiness, maintenance overhead, and skill gaps in large teams.
Prepare a detailed report outlining the implementation roadmap, success factors, ROI analysis, and recommendations for sustainable Selenium automation in Agile environments.